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

Tegnap szembesültem a widget létrehozásának problémájával Bolti információk üzembe helyezni Az online boltok minősítő portálja, amelyet a Kereskedő Egyesület hogy tudja használni.

Sajnos ehhez nincs plugin a Shopware Store-on keresztül. Tehát a kódokat kézzel kellett elhelyezni.

Ehhez először konfiguráltam a bolt információs widgetet a webhely hátterében.

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

Ezt követően a kód egy kicsit mélyebben elérhető.

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

A következő lépésben ezt a kódot beszúrtam a láblécbe. Indítsa el az ftp programot (pl. Filezilla), és keresse meg:

/Témák/Frontend/YourThemeName/frontend/index

Ezen a ponton feltételezem, hogy már a saját témáját használja, különben a változtatások nem lennének frissítésbiztosak. Ellenkező esetben a Shopware ezt a dokumentációt biztosítja:

Változtassa meg a sablont

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

Mindig készítek biztonsági másolatot az aktuális fájlról a módosítások előtt, és hozzáadom az aktuális dátumot a névhez.

Szövegszerkesztővel (pl. Notepad++) illessze be a fenti kódot.

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

Most a widget megjelenik Shopware online boltjának alsó részén. Persze nem néz ki olyan jól. Ezért az üzlet információi tartalmaznak egy kis kódrészletet, amely határozottan elhelyezi ezt a widgetet a jobb alsó sarokban:

@media only screen and (min-width: 768px) { div#shopauskunft_widget { display: block; pozíció: rögzített; jobbra: 10px; alsó: 10px; }}

De mit kell vele csinálni?

További css-fájl is megadható a Showare háttérprogramjában. Először töltsön fel egy új css fájlt a fenti kóddal ftp-n keresztül.

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

Most már csak azt kell mondania a Shopware 5-nek, hogy ezt a fájlt kell használni. Ehhez lépjen a háttérbe Beállítások/ Témakezelő...

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

... válassza ki a témát, és kattintson a Téma konfigurálása gombra.

A Konfiguráció fül alatt...

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

… írja be a css fájlját az „Egyéb CSS-fájlok” alatt:

<link href="/hu/themes/Frontend/YourThemeName/frontend/_public/src/css/shopauskunft.css?template=itintime_170425&is_preview=on" media="all" rel="stylesheet" type="text/css" />

Most ürítse ki a bolt gyorsítótárát, és fordítsa le a témát.

Törölje a Shopware 5 gyorsítótárát

Et íme… a widgeted jól néz ki! 🙂

Integrálja saját képelemeit (widgetjeit) (példa az üzlet információs widgeten)

Az értékelő e-mailek elküldéséhez továbbra is szükség van az üzlet információiból származó RBA widgetre. Ebben a bejegyzésben megmutatom, hogyan kell beállítani:

Telepítse az RBA widgetet a Shopware 5 bolt információiból